Summary of KCSO Officer Involved Shooting
On June 12, 2020, at about 10:25 am, the Kern County Sheriff’s Office received a call of an individual banging on the front door of an apartment in the 300-block of Water Street. It was reported that the individual, 36-year-old Jacob Morales, was armed with a handgun, under the influence of unknown drugs and violating a restraining order. Deputies responded to the residence and contacted Morales in the north alley of Water Street. Morales immediately fled on foot toward the apartment containing the original victims. As Morales fled toward the apartment, he was armed with what was believed to be a firearm in his hand when he was confronted by additional deputies. Morales failed to comply with commands and continued toward the apartment. Two deputies discharged their firearms striking Morales. Morales was then taken into custody and found to be in possession of a realistic replica firearm and a knife. Morales was transported via ambulance to a local hospital and treated for his non-life-threatening injuries. Morales was subsequently booked into the Kern County Jail for charges of threatening with the intent to terrorize, stalking resisting a peace officer and exhibiting a replica firearm. The deputies involved were placed on routine administrative leave pending the outcome of the investigation.
